  • Patent number: 11959446
    Abstract: A director plate retainer of a fluid injector includes an outer wall which is annular in shape and which extends from an outer wall first end to an outer wall second end and which is centered about an axis. The director plate retainer also includes a lateral wall which is annular in shape and which extends toward the axis from a radially outer extent, which is proximal to the outer wall, to a radially inner extent, which is distal from the outer wall. The director plate retainer also includes an inner wall which is annular in shape and which extends from an inner wall first end, which is proximal to the lateral wall, to an inner wall second end, which is distal from the lateral wall, the inner wall extending along the axis in a direction that is opposite from the outer wall.

  • Publication number: 20040051067
    Abstract: In a solenoid-actuated pintle valve assembly, the solenoid assembly is shrouded by a manifold jacket connected via an opening to a source of air at a pressure higher than the working gas pressure within the valve chamber. During operation of the valve and solenoid assembly, a low mass flow of air is forced continuously throughout the solenoid assembly and exits through any leaks in the jacket and along the bushing bores into the valve chamber. Thus, the bushing bore and solenoid assembly are actively protected against entry of contaminants. Further, since it is no longer necessary to vent the valve to permit the escape of gases leaking along the bushing bores, contaminant-laden gases are kept from being exhausted into the engine compartment and from leaving a carbon track residue. The invention is especially useful for exhaust gas recirculation valves on internal combustion engines.
